Cocoa programming
Books in this subject area deal with Cocoa: one of Apple Inc.'s native object-oriented application program environments for the Mac OS X operating system. Cocoa applications are typically developed using the development tools provided by Apple, and as such usually have a distinctive feel, since the Cocoa programming environment automates many aspects of an application to comply with Apple's human interface guidelines.
